Venus’s mean radius is 6,051. 8 km (3,760. 4 miles), or about 95 percent of Earth’s at the Equator, while its mass is 4. 87 × 1024 kg, or 81. 5 percent that of Earth. The similarities to Earth in size and mass produce a similarity in density—5. 24 grams per cubic centimetre for Venus ... Web22 Dec 2024 · The four rocky planets of the inner Solar System: Mercury, Venus, Earth, and Mars. Approximately 4.6 billion years ago in the early days of our Solar System, a disk of dust and gases orbited the young Sun. Two theories describe how in the course of millions of years the inner rocky planets formed from this original building material. Web5 Mar 2008 · Venus’s atmosphere is thick and dense, whereas that of Mars is light and tenuous. Despite the differences, the magnetometer instruments have discovered that the structure of the magnetic fields of both planets are alike. “This is because the density of the ionosphere at 250 km altitude is surprisingly similar,” says Tielong Zhang ...
